Okay, everybody dug the “art doesn’t go bad” post, so I’m gonna make a follow-up that probably won’t go over so well. If you find yourself getting constantly angry or frustrated at the way someone else is telling a story…maybe consider…that story just doesn’t have to be for you. It isn’t necessarily bad. It’s just the way the storyteller is choosing to do their thing. And maybe a good deal of why you don’t like it is a sense of ownership of someone else’s story being told as you personally wouldn’t tell it. Maybe you’ve got an idea in mind of how you want it to go, and they’re taking a different path. Which is okay and very normal to feel! But it does mean you might want to move on to another story, or tell one yourself, instead of insisting the thing you’re watching/reading/etc is just absolute garbage. Your interpretation of someone else’s story is not gospel; nor should it be. Making peace with that is just part of the deal.

Really hate how Dead Men Tell No Tales completely undermines the bittersweet ending of Elizabeth and Will's story at the end of World's End.
Jones basically forced them apart, therefore continuing the cycle that he and Calipso were put upon years before. By stabbing Will, Jones ultimately caused Jack to have to rethink his plan. Jack did the right thing by making Will stab Jones' heart, but it came at a cost. Jack and Elizabeth knew that, but they still put it forward.
When you first watch the movie, you want them to make it out of the battle. You feel helpless when Will gets killed. And you feel relief when he returns alive on the Dutchman. But you also know at the back of your mind that there's still the matter of Will not being able to see Elizabeth again for 10 years.
That's what makes their ending work so well here. Yes, it's such a bittersweet ending, and yes it's gut wrenching when Elizabeth has to watch Will and the Dutchman disappear over the horizon; but it teaches a lesson that, yes, it does suck. And you're not always going to get complete happy endings. As a kid first watching this movie, I accepted that. It's a valuable lesson to take with you.
So of course I'm going to be salty about the fact that they took away this remorseful yet very important ending for these two.

2024 reads / storygraph
Moonstorm
YA space opera
a young girl who was taken by the empire after her people’s moon was destroyed is given the chance to become a mech pilot after an attack on their boarding school leaves their class stranded on an imperial space fleet
while it’s been her dream to become a pilot, the training is not what she expected, and there is more to the lancer mechs than the general public knows
when her past catches up with her, she starts to be confronted with where her loyalties lie
queer & nonbinary characters, no romance
